Abstract

The Internet of Things (IOT) has been widely used to interconnect the available medical resources and offersmart, reliable, and effective healthcare service to the elderly people. Health monitoring for active and assistedliving is one of the paradigms that can use the IOT advantages to improve the elderly lifestyle. In this project,we present an IOT architecture customized for healthcare applications. The proposed architecture collects thedata and sent to the cloud where it is processed and analyzed. Feedback actions based on the analyzed data canbe sent back to the user. A prototype of the proposed architecture has been built to demonstrate its performance advantages.
